Note: The SN1 mechanism, a carbocation form in first step. The carbocation is the intermediate of SN1types reactions. Carbocation is an electron-deficient species. So, the electron-donating group stabilizes the carbocation. Electron-withdrawing groups destabilize the carbocation. The more the number of electron-donating groups the more stable the carbocation will be. Here, all the carbocations are secondary. If all carbocations are different then the stability order of the carbocations, 1∘<2∘<3∘.
